Comprehending the Goethe B1 Exam
Before diving into cost-efficient ways to deal with the B1 exam, it's necessary to comprehend what it requires. The Goethe B1 Exam examines language efficiency at a limit level, focusing on the following capabilities:
Listening: Understanding conversations and discussions in standard German.Reading: Comprehending texts experienced in daily life such as pamphlets and leisure short articles.Writing: Producing easy texts, such as personal letters and emails.Speaking: Participating in everyday discussions and talking about familiar subjects.

The cost of taking the Goethe B1 Exam can differ depending on the exam location and screening center. Below is a breakdown of potential costs:
Country/RegionApproximated CostGermanyEUR150 - EUR170AustriaEUR140 - EUR160SwitzerlandCHF 200 - CHF 250Online RegistrationVaries (check particular centers)Financial Aid and Discounts
For individuals who might find exam fees prohibitive, some language schools and cultural institutions offer scholarships or discount rates. It's worth asking at local German cultural centers or language institutions concerning financial help choices.

A: Preparation time varies from individual to private. Usually, learners might require between 3-6 months of constant study to successfully get ready for the B1 exam.
Q: What are some ideas for the speaking area?
A: To master the speaking section, practice regularly with a partner, tape your actions to sample concerns, and focus on everyday vocabulary.
Q: Are there any recommended apps for practicing German?
A: Yes! Suggested apps consist of Duolingo, Babbel, and Memrise, which provide engaging formats for vocabulary and grammar practice.
Q: Can I retake the exam if I don't pass?
A: Yes, people can retake the Goethe B1 Exam as often times as needed. However, it's recommended to spend some time to prepare before trying a retake.
Q: Is the Goethe B1 acknowledged worldwide?
A: Yes, the Goethe B1 certification is recognized throughout numerous organizations in German-speaking nations and numerous other international settings as proof of language competency.
